Fueling Problem at Start?

Recently my truck will not start sometimes and I am out of ideas as to why. Sometimes it will start the first time I crank it, and other times it won't start for ten minutes. Also sometimes when it won't start I turn the key on and off a few times then it cranks right up. I have had it turn on in the drive way for a second then cut off. I put in a new crankshaft position sensor yesterday and that didn't do the trick. I've been told my truck doesn't have a fuel solenoid, so I don't really understand how the fuel gets told to be sent and then shut off. I'm sure it is some electrical problem where fuel is not getting sent because it cranks without any problem but won't fire sometimes. I am all out of ideas so any help is greatly appreciated! Do you have a fuel pressure gauge? If so what's your fuel pressure?... If not I would get one!

If its not throwing any codes, first I would suggest looking at the entire fuel system to make sure there isn't a place that air is entering the fuel causing the hard starting.

Yep, could be a loss of prime, would explain why it starts after bumping the key a few times ( reprimes ).

Fuel pressure gauge is the first step.

my truck has had this problem ever since I had the engine ecm replaced and the dealer did the "software update" which aparently changed how the lift pump operates at start up

my truck used to fire right off with almost no cranking also the lp used to run for a long time when the key was turnred to the on position and prime the injector pump

ever since the update turn the key forward and there is no pressure since the lp runs for afraction of a second wait for the light to go out and start cranking till it runs, if I bump the key the pump will run like it used to just don't like to do that

all I see this update doing is wear out my starter faster, this update was done 4+ years ago
